A student’s academic journey has always included homework as a crucial component. Many students today find it difficult to keep up with assignments, even when they reinforce what they learn in the classroom. The difficulties are genuine, ranging from stressful homework to ineffective time management. Continue reading to learn why students struggle with homework and how parents may support them.

How to Overcome the Homework Challenges

Having trouble with your homework? To stay focused and stress-free, divide things into smaller stages, create a timetable, cut out distractions, and ask for assistance when necessary.

Poor Time Management: Underestimating the length of tasks is one of the main causes of students’ difficulties. Many people put off doing their job until the last minute, which results in hurried labor, worry, and poorer grades. Students frequently feel stressed and unable to effectively manage their workload due to their numerous classes and extracurricular activities.

  • The Fix: Students should begin by making a plan and dividing assignments into smaller, more doable activities. You can keep track of deadlines by using tools like digital calendars, study apps, and planners.

Lack of Topic Understanding: Students occasionally lack confidence regarding the topic matter or the guidelines for the task. They will inevitably put off starting or get annoyed while working if they don’t know what is expected of them.

  • The Fix: Is for students to seek Assignment Help as soon as they get confused. Online resources, instructors, and fellow students can all offer explanations. Topic comprehension is further enhanced by taking appropriate notes and participating in class discussions.

Distraction and Procrastination: Distractions exist in today’s world, including social media, smartphones, games, and streaming services in Singapore. Students find it challenging to maintain concentration because they constantly contend for their attention. When a task seems challenging, procrastination becomes a simple habit.

  • The Fix: Making your desk distraction-free can have a significant impact. The Pomodoro method, which entails studying in brief, concentrated moments with breaks in between, is one strategy that students might employ.

Fear of Failure and Low Confidence: Some pupils struggle because they don’t think they can succeed. They could be worried about making mistakes or being evaluated, which prevents them from beginning or finishing things. Stress and poor performance may result from this emotional barrier.

  • The Fix: Positive self-talk and practice boost confidence. Pupils should keep in mind that making mistakes is a necessary aspect of learning. They should concentrate on making progress rather than aiming for perfection.

Mental Health Problems: Students are increasingly experiencing stress, poor sleep, anxiety, and depression. Focus and productivity quickly decline when mental health is compromised. Instead of being an opportunity to learn, assignments can sometimes feel like a burden.

  • The Fix: It’s critical to keep a good balance between personal and educational responsibilities. Students should prioritize sleep, exercise, and positive routines.

Insufficient Resources or Assistance: Not every student has access to textbooks, dependable internet, peaceful fields of study, or supportive advice. It gets far more difficult to finish assignments without these resources.

  • The Fix: Educational institutions should endeavor to guarantee equitable access to academic assistance. Libraries, study groups, mentoring services, and free online learning resources are all available to students.
